How to Spot Fake Paco Rabanne Ultraviolet

Examine the Packaging and Outer Box

The packaging of Paco Rabanne Ultraviolet is meticulously designed, reflecting the brand’s luxury standards. A counterfeit version often falls short in quality and detail. Here’s what to look for:

  • Box Quality: Genuine boxes are made from high-quality, sturdy cardboard with a smooth matte or glossy finish. Fake boxes may feel flimsy, rough, or have uneven textures.
  • Print Quality: Check the print clarity on the box. The original features sharp, vibrant, and well-aligned text and images. Fakes often have blurry, smudged, or faded printing.
  • Color Consistency: The authentic Ultraviolet box showcases consistent and accurate colors, especially the purple hues. Counterfeits may have dull or off-color tones.
  • Seal and Stickers: Genuine boxes come sealed with high-quality tamper-proof stickers. Fake packaging might lack proper seals or use cheap stickers that peel easily.

Inspect the Bottle and Cap

The perfume bottle itself is a key indicator of authenticity. Pay close attention to these details:

  • Design and Shape: The real Ultraviolet bottle features a sleek, well-defined design with precise lines. Counterfeit bottles may be misshapen, have uneven edges, or look poorly manufactured.
  • Material Quality: Authentic bottles are made from high-quality glass with a smooth finish. Fake bottles often feel lighter, thinner, or have rough surfaces.
  • Color and Logo: The purple color of the perfume should be rich and vibrant. The Paco Rabanne logo embossed or printed on the bottle must be clear, sharp, and correctly positioned.
  • Cap and Sprayer: The cap of a genuine Ultraviolet is sturdy and fits snugly. Fake caps may be loose, misaligned, or made from cheap plastic. Test the spray; authentic bottles have a smooth, consistent mist.

Check the Perfume’s Liquid and Scent

While the scent can sometimes be mimicked, the quality of the perfume liquid can reveal fakes:

  • Color Consistency: The genuine perfume has a consistent, rich purple hue. Fakes might have discoloration or cloudy liquid.
  • Smell: Authentic Ultraviolet exudes a complex, well-balanced aroma. Fake versions may smell off, overly synthetic, or have a chemical scent.
  • Perfume Longevity: Genuine perfume maintains its scent for hours. If the fragrance fades quickly or smells different from what you expect, it might be counterfeit.

Verify the Authenticity via Serial Numbers and Labels

Most genuine Paco Rabanne fragrances include specific identifiers:

  • Serial Number: Check for a serial number or batch code printed on the bottle or box. Authentic products have a clear, printed code that can often be verified online or through brand customer service.
  • Label Quality: The label on the bottle should be perfectly aligned, with no smudges or printing errors. The font should match official branding.
  • Holograms and Security Features: Some versions include holographic stickers or security seals. Fake products usually lack such features or have poorly replicated ones.

Buy from Reputable Retailers

One of the most effective ways to avoid counterfeit products is purchasing from trusted sources:

  • Official Brand Stores: Always buy from Paco Rabanne’s official boutiques or website.
  • Authorized Retailers: Select authorized department stores and well-known perfume shops.
  • Avoid Suspicious Online Sellers: Be cautious of significantly discounted prices or unverified sellers on online marketplaces.
